WebDuring the second week after fertilization, cells in the embryo migrate to form three distinct cell layers, called the ectoderm, mesoderm, and endoderm. Each layer will soon develop into different types of cells and tissues, as shown in Figure below. Cell Layers of the Embryo. The migration of cells into three layers occurs in the 2-week-old ... Stem Cells and Potency Stem cells are unspecialised cells which have the ability to become specialised cells, such as heart cells or neurons.
